It's a weird slate on Saturday with the top few pitchers not having great matchups and the rest being a mix of mediocre and bad options. I parsed through the matchups and found a couple cheaper arms in decent spots that should rack up strikeouts at a minimum. And with cheaper pitchers come expensive bats.

PITCHER

Tyler Mahle, CIN vs. MIA ($34): Mahle has had some bad outings, but he's also hit 29 fantasy points in three of his six starts. More impressive is that he's carved through decent lineups in his last two starts with 18 strikeouts against the Twins and Braves. The Marlins are still at the bottom of most lists against righties with a .092 ISO and .267 wOBA to go with a 24.8 K%.

Trevor Cahill, OAK vs. BAL ($37):
Conveniently, I'm going against the second-worst lineup in the league against righties in the Orioles, who have a higher 25.1 K% and equally bad .280 wOBA. Cahill has done well to hold fantasy value against good lineups and has reached 15 fantasy points in all three of his starts. The last time he faced a below-average lineup was when he went through the White Sox for eight strikeouts in seven innings.

CATCHER

Omar Narvaez, CWS vs. MIN ($7): You need at least one lefty in your lineup against Lance Lynn, and Narvaez is my pick as long as Welington Castillo continues to miss time with stomach pain. Narvaez doesn't cost a thing and had a decent .324 wOBA against right-handers last season. Lynn hasn't done many things right this season with 17 runs allowed in his last three starts and a negative-11.1 K-BB% against lefty bats. In a bigger sample, Lynn was still bad in 2017 against lefties with a 5.93 xFIP.

FIRST BASE

Cody Bellinger, LAD at SD ($20): Bellinger is a good spot to spend against a pitcher who has given up at least three runs in his last four starts to go with a negative-6.4 K-BB%. Bryan Mitchell doesn't have a ton of experience in the majors, but his .341 wOBA allowed to 237 lefties faced isn't good. Bellinger should take advantage of that with a career .300 ISO against righties.

SECOND BASE

Brian Dozier, MIN at CWS ($16): I had Yoan Moncada here until he left with a hamstring injury Friday night. Dozier can at least provide the same power against a pitcher who is starting out of necessity. Hector Santiago couldn't make it five innings in his only start this season and all eight of his appearances have come in White Sox losses. As a starter last year, Santiago managed a 5.71 xFIP against right-handed batters. That'll do for Dozier, who rocked southpaws for a .303 ISO and .437 wOBA last season.

THIRD BASE

Jeimer Candelario, DET at KC ($18): Candelario is a switch hitter with better numbers against righty arms. He already has 13 extra-base hits against right-handers this season and sports a solid .355 wOBA against them in his career. Jason Hammel was blown up for eight runs in his previous start and while he went nine against the Tigers a couple weeks ago, Candelario was one of the few with a hit. Hammel also had a poor 5.15 xFIP against lefty bats last season.

SHORTSTOP

Jurickson Profar, TEX vs. BOS ($11): Profar has shown a bit more pop this season and most of that has come against southpaws. He doesn't cost much and faces Eduardo Rodriguez, who struggled against the Royals last time out. The lefty hurler has three wins, but that's mostly due to the bats behind him. His career 4.41 xFIP against righties is subpar and should help Profar.

OUTFIELD

Christian Yelich, MIL vs. PIT ($19): Since Jameson Taillon fell apart three starts ago, I've been using at least one bat against him. Yelich gets the call in this one after last season's .359 wOBA against righties. Taillon has given up 15 runs in his last three starts and has a career .331 wOBA allowed against lefty bats.

J.D. Martinez, BOS at TEX ($24):
If you have the money, Mookie Betts is always the play if you want someone from the Red Sox, but for a few bucks cheaper, Martinez could be just as good in this game. He's been roping with 17 hits (three homers) in his last 10 games and, more important, destroyed southpaws for a .516 ISO and .531 wOBA last season. Cole Hamels isn't having a bad season, but he's already given up eight home runs to right-handers and had a 5.01 xFIP against them last year.

Alex Verdugo, LAD at SD ($12):
Verdugo is the place to go for a cheap outfielder in a great spot. At the least, Verdugo has supplied four doubles in eight hits this season and faces a struggling Mitchell that has a career 4.97 xFIP against lefty bats. Mitchell has also walked more batters than he's struck out this season.
